Long overdue report, been a busy few weeks after. Had a backcountry river float on the Goodnews River in late August/early September. SW Alaska had been getting hammered with rain. We showed up and learned no flights had gone out for two days which led to seeing way more of Bethel than we hoped. Got lucky and were able to jump the queue due to location of our float with only a day of delay to our trip of seven days.
Had a break in the weather and got to start with clear skies, sun, and good spirits.
Found some stinky rotten pinks right out of the lake and they provided side action for much of the trip.
Got in to some nice rainbows late on the first day and early second and hopes were high.
Got to a slow non-fishy stretch of river and decided to pick up the pace and cover some ground to make up time. Turns out we should have spent more time up high where we found some nice bows. Saw plenty of wildlife though and missed a pic of the wolf we saw.
